EXCEEDS logo
Exceeds
Piotrek Koszuliński

PROFILE

Piotrek Koszuliński

Worked extensively on the ckeditor/ckeditor5 repository, delivering features and improvements across licensing, documentation, and front end functionality. Enhanced code clarity and maintainability through code hygiene updates and refactoring, using TypeScript and JavaScript to streamline onboarding and reduce technical debt. Implemented dual-licensing and standardized license metadata, improving compliance and documentation quality. Expanded test coverage and robustness for autolinking, and introduced UI refinements such as vertical margin alignment for code blocks using CSS. Focused on clear release notes and policy documentation, supporting enterprise users with predictable upgrade paths. Demonstrated a methodical approach to repository maintenance, technical writing, and open source compliance.

Overall Statistics

Feature vs Bugs

91%Features

Repository Contributions

33Total
Bugs
1
Commits
33
Features
10
Lines of code
2,621
Activity Months8

Work History

March 2026

1 Commits • 1 Features

Mar 1, 2026

March 2026: Delivered Code Block Visual Layout Enhancement in ckeditor/ckeditor5, adding vertical margins to code block content styles to align with other block widgets and improve editor readability. The change fixes visual misalignment and supports a consistent editing experience. Commit reference: 89926f84bc0667be1ba1e318cf433c987bbae6b3; addresses #19982.

October 2025

1 Commits • 1 Features

Oct 1, 2025

October 2025: Delivered CKEditor AI Release Notes Clarification in ckeditor/ckeditor5 to improve release notes readability without impacting core functionality. This change focuses on documentation quality and release-process clarity, ensuring AI-related changes are easy to locate and review while preserving semantics.

September 2025

7 Commits • 1 Features

Sep 1, 2025

Month: 2025-09 — CKEditor 5 Documentation Improvements: LTS Edition and Versioning Policy implemented for ckeditor/ckeditor5. Focused on consolidating and clarifying LTS guidance, breaking changes policy, versioning, release channels, and access to alpha/nightly releases. No major bugs fixed this month; primary deliverables are documentation and policy improvements aimed at enterprise stability and predictable upgrade paths. Overall impact: improved enterprise clarity, reduced onboarding risk, and smoother deployment of CKEditor 5 in production. Technologies/skills demonstrated include technical writing, release management, policy design, cross-team collaboration, and conflict resolution during doc edits.

April 2025

2 Commits • 1 Features

Apr 1, 2025

Month: 2025-04 — Focused on strengthening CKEditor 5 autolinking in the ckeditor/ckeditor5 repository. Delivered robustness enhancements, expanded test coverage for block limit elements, and performed targeted code cleanup to reduce technical debt while preserving existing behavior. These changes improve autolinking reliability for content authors and reduce risk of regressions in future releases.

March 2025

10 Commits • 3 Features

Mar 1, 2025

March 2025 monthly summary for repository ckeditor/ckeditor5 focusing on business value, technical improvements, and impact across licensing/compliance, heading configuration, and autolink features.

January 2025

1 Commits

Jan 1, 2025

January 2025 (2025-01) monthly summary for ckeditor/ckeditor5: No new features released; delivered a focused license documentation readability improvement. The change enhances compliance clarity for users and suppliers, reduces potential confusion in licensing text, and maintains high documentation quality.

November 2024

9 Commits • 2 Features

Nov 1, 2024

November 2024 monthly summary for ckeditor/ckeditor5 focusing on licensing updates and onboarding improvements. Key outcomes include dual-licensing implementation across the repository, licensing metadata standardization, documentation alignment, and an onboarding flow change directing users to a dedicated free-trial checkout page. Impact includes reduced licensing ambiguity, improved compliance readiness, and a smoother onboarding funnel.

October 2024

2 Commits • 1 Features

Oct 1, 2024

Monthly summary for 2024-10 focused on the ckeditor/ckeditor5 Editor module. Delivered code hygiene enhancements: clarified license key execution comment and removed trailing whitespace in editor.ts, improving readability and maintainability without changing behavior. This work reduces onboarding time and minimizes risk of misinterpretation in the Editor module.

Activity

Loading activity data...

Quality Metrics

Correctness97.8%
Maintainability97.6%
Architecture95.8%
Performance95.8%
AI Usage20.0%

Skills & Technologies

Programming Languages

CSSGPLHTMLJSONJavaScriptMarkdownTypeScript

Technical Skills

CSSCode DocumentationCode FormattingCode RefactoringCode StyleContent ManagementDependency ManagementDocumentationDocumentation ManagementEditor DevelopmentFront End DevelopmentJavaScriptLegalLicense ManagementLicensing

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

ckeditor/ckeditor5

Oct 2024 Mar 2026
8 Months active

Languages Used

TypeScriptJSONJavaScriptMarkdownGPLHTMLCSS

Technical Skills

Code DocumentationCode FormattingCode StyleDocumentationLegalLicense Management